This Reading Comprehension Text in German provides an in-depth look at the history of Oktoberfest, making it an excellent addition to your German language lessons. Spanning 2 pages, this resource features engaging visuals to enhance student understanding and interest.

This product includes two versions: one in German and one in English.

The accompanying worksheets are thoughtfully designed to include a variety of question types: full-sentence answers, true/false statements, and multiple-choice questions. In addition to these, there is a Word Bank activity where students match words with pictures, reinforcing their literacy and comprehension skills. Answer keys are included.

This product is perfect for middle school students, offering a detailed exploration of Oktoberfest’s origins, its significance as a holiday in Germany, and its cultural impact.

The flexible design allows teachers to select the activities that best suit their students’ needs, making lesson planning straightforward and effective.
